Isa 49:4 · Douay-Rheims
“And I said: I have laboured in vain, I have spent my strength without cause and in vain: therefore my judgment is with the Lord, and my work with my God.”
On this verse:
“Then I said. Then I, the prophet, said. I said to myself, I have laboured in vain. I have troubled myself in vain to rebuke Israel; they do not hearken. My judgment is with God. He will reward me for my trouble. ופעלתי And my wages. Comp. שביר פעלת the wages of one that is hired (Lev. 19:13)”
